- Hemi-Synthesis and Anti-Oomycete Activity of Analogues of Isocordoin
-
An efficient synthesis of a series of 4-oxyalkyl-isocordoin analogues (2–8) is reported for the first time. Their structures were confirmed by1H-NMR,13C-NMR, and HRMS. Their anti-oomycete activity was evaluated by mycelium and spores inhibition assay against two selected pathogenic oomycetes strains: Saprolegnia parasitica and Saprolegnia australis. The entire series of isocordoin derivatives (except compound 7) showed high inhibitory activity against these oomycete strains. Among them, compound 2 exhibited strong activity, with minimum inhibitory concentration (MIC) and minimum oomyceticidal concentration (MOC) values of 50 μg/mL and 75 μg/mL, respectively. The results showed that 4-oxyalkylated analogues of isocordoin could be potential anti-oomycete agents.

- Synthesis and antibacterial activity of chalcones bearing prenyl or geranyl groups from Angelica keiskei
-
Chalcones bearing prenyl or geranyl groups from Angelica keiskei, such as 4-hydroxyderricin (1a), xanthoangelol (1e), xanthoangelol F (1f), xanthoangelol H (2), deoxyxanthoangelol H (3), and deoxydihydroxanthoangelol H (4) and their derivatives were synthesized. From the evaluation of antibacterial activity of the synthesized chalcones, 1a, isobavachalcone (1b), 1e, 1f, bavachalcone (5a), and broussochalcone B (5b) were found to inhibit Gram-positive bacteria.
